Importance Of The Right Shampoo-Conditioner Combo
According to a study, your hair has two different requirements, one product for the scalp and one for the shaft of the hair.
Hair roots require cleansing because they are closer to the scalp, which produces oil or sebum. As our sebaceous and oil glands release oil and moisture to keep our roots from falling, they leave some excess oil that becomes the base for dirt, pollution, and other impurities to stick. This means you need a product that reduces the oil content on the base. But is that the case with the rest of your hair? Well, no.
The shaft of your hair receives moisture from the scalp but that’s not enough. It tends to get dry and frizzy and requires conditioning more than cleansing. Thus, your scalp requires shampoo and your shaft needs conditioner.
Therefore, you can’t use the same product or products with similar ingredients in your shampoo and conditioner when you expect different results.

FAQs
1. How often should I wash my hair?
Ideally twice a week, but if you sweat a lot or the climate is too hot and humid, you can wash your hair every other day. Avoid washing your hair every day, as frequent washing can strip your hair of its natural oils.
2. Should I use shampoo and conditioner of the same brand?
Not necessarily, look for the ingredients and the results it promises before buying a product. But if you have brand loyalty, go ahead, as long as it helps your hair.
3. Can I put conditioner before shampoo?
Yes, absolutely you can! This is called reverse shampooing, where you condition your hair first and then cleanse it. Learn more about reverse shampooing here.
